    A Legacy of Light and Lineage

    The story of Harold Gresley is one deeply woven into the very fabric of the English landscape and a profound familial heritage. Born in 1892, Gresley did not merely enter the world as an individual artist, but as the next chapter in a distinguished lineage of painters. He was the son of Frank Gresley and the grandson of James Stephen Gresley, both of whom were notable figures in the British art scene. This ancestral connection provided him with more than just a name; it offered a lifelong immersion in the nuances of light, shadow, and the delicate textures of the natural world. His early training at the Derby School of Art served as the crucible where his inherited passion met formal discipline, allowing him to master the versatile mediums of both watercolour and oil.

    However, the trajectory of his life was irrevocably altered by the shadows of the Great War. Enlisting in the 1st Battalion of the Royal Fusiliers, Gresley transitioned from the quiet studios of Derbyshire to the harrowing landscapes of the Western Front and the Balkans. It was during this period of immense upheaval that he demonstrated a bravery that mirrored the strength found in his art. For his exceptional gallantry—specifically his ability to navigate through intense barrages to gather vital intelligence—he was awarded the Distinguished Conduct Medal (DCM). This profound experience of conflict and resilience would undoubtedly have informed the emotional depth and gravity present in his later, more somber portraiture.

    The Romanticism of the Derbyshire Wilds

    Upon returning to a changed world, Gresley continued his artistic evolution, seeking further refinement under the guidance of Arthur Spooner in Nottingham. This period of post-war study allowed him to refine a style that could be described as a bridge between classical precision and Romantic expressionism. He became particularly renowned for his ability to capture the atmospheric soul of the Derbyshire countryside. In works such as “Dovedale, Derbyshire,” one can witness his mastery of perspective; he utilized expressive brushwork and a sophisticated understanding of atmospheric haze to transform rugged terrain into something ethereal and awe-inspiring.

    His landscapes were never merely topographical records; they were emotional evocations. Through the use of oil on canvas, he could layer colors to create a sense of depth that invited the viewer to step into the mist-covered valleys. His ability to manipulate light—capturing the way it breaks through heavy clouds or settles upon a tranquil stream—remains a hallmark of his contribution to British landscape painting. This dedication to the essence of place ensured that his work resonated with a sense of timelessness, celebrating the enduring beauty of the English Midlands.

    Dignity in Detail: The Art of Portraiture

    While the sweeping vistas of the Peak District defined much of his fame, Gresley possessed a secondary, equally formidable talent for portraiture. If his landscapes were about the vastness of nature, his portraits were about the intimacy of the human spirit. He approached the human face with a meticulous, academic rigor, seeking to convey not just likeness, but character and social standing. His "Portrait of an Unknown Chairman of Derbyshire County Council"* stands as a testament to this skill, utilizing realistic techniques and careful attention to detail—such as the rendering of medals and fabric textures—to project an aura of authority and quiet dignity.

    This duality in his oeuvre—the ability to move from the expansive, atmospheric landscape to the concentrated, psychological depth of a portrait—marks him as a truly versatile master. His later years, including his time as a teacher at Repton School, allowed him to pass this technical wisdom to a new generation, ensuring that the traditions he inherited would continue to flourish. Today, much of his significant output is preserved in the Derby Museum and Art Gallery, serving as a permanent record of an artist who found profound beauty in both the wild expanses of the earth and the dignified faces of his fellow man.
